American parents have registered 2,665 Mckays since 1880, against 817 Mckenzees. Mckay is still ahead, with 40 babies in 2025.

Who was ahead

Mckay has been the commoner name in every year either was published, 1917 to 2025. The lead has never changed hands.

The closest they came was 2008, when Mckay had 62 and Mckenzee had 42.

Which name is older

Half of the Mckays alive today are over 21; half the Mckenzees are over 19. That is 2 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
